Poster Type Original, vintage, 1975 US one-sheet (measures 27" x 41" / 104cm x 68.8cm). This is known as the 'clocks style' one-sheet (there were several poster designs for Dog Day Afternoon.)
Overall Condition Grade & Details Very Good to Fine. Two minor border tears, original foldlines but poster has been carefully stored flat. No pinholes or tape.
